Frequently Asked Questions
What's the difference between Digrin and Financial Modeling Prep (FMP)?
Digrin focuses on Portfolio, Screeners, and Dividends while Financial Modeling Prep (FMP) specializes in Screeners, Data APIs, and News. They overlap in 5 categories, so choose based on your preferred workflow and pricing.

Does Digrin or Financial Modeling Prep (FMP) have an API?
Financial Modeling Prep (FMP) provides API access for programmatic data retrieval and custom integrations. Digrin doesn't currently offer an API, so you'll need to use their web interface.
Should I choose Digrin or Financial Modeling Prep (FMP)?
Choose Digrin if you need Portfolio tracking for dividend investors: portfolio value, annual dividends, Yield on Cost (YoC), XIRR, gain/loss, dividend yield/YoC columns, and transaction history views., and Dividend tools: portfolio dividend calendar (paid, announced, and projected dividends) plus public “Upcoming Ex‑Dividends” lists with dividend yield, years paying, and frequency.. Go with Financial Modeling Prep (FMP) if Multi‑asset data coverage via a single API: equities, ETFs, mutual funds, indexes, forex, crypto, commodities, macroeconomic indicators, ESG and ownership datasets, organized into Market Data, Fundamental & Company Data, News & Calendar Data, Advanced Data, Ownership and Other Markets., and Real‑time quotes plus intraday (1‑minute, 5‑minute, 30‑minute, 1‑hour) and end‑of‑day historical bars for stocks and other assets; Premium and Ultimate tiers add intraday chart endpoints, technical indicators and up to 30+ years of history, with Ultimate including 1‑minute intraday charting and full historical access. better fits how you invest.
What asset classes do Digrin and Financial Modeling Prep (FMP) cover?
Both cover Stocks, and ETFs. Financial Modeling Prep (FMP) adds coverage for Mutual Funds, Funds, Currencies, Cryptos, Commodities, and Other.
Does Digrin or Financial Modeling Prep (FMP) have real-time data?
Financial Modeling Prep (FMP) offers real-time data feeds, which is essential for active traders. Digrin uses delayed or end-of-day data, which works fine for longer-term investors who don't need up-to-the-second quotes.
